    On Friday, July 10,  Dell was clearing land to make way for parking at our home in the country.   He had already taken down several trees and was getting ready to chainsaw his last pine when it fell toward our house.   With no time to reason, he yelled, oh no, and put out his arms to stop the tree.   Instead , he found himself on his back with a 2 ton tree across his abdomen.
       If the tree had not fallen on the house, I would never have heard his cries for help.  With very little oxygen expanding his lungs, he cried for me .  Sweating profusely and short of breath, he told me to go get a board from the barn.  Of course, I was crying and calling 911 and our neighbor 
 while running to the barn and wondering if Dell would be alive when I returned.  .  I grabbed the first board I could find and dragged it back to him while calling out to him.   
     Dell said, he told the Lord that he was not scared to die but please let him live for me.    Once I got to him, he had the calmness and clarity to tell me exactly how to place the board to be able to leverage the tree off his abdomen just to allow enough time for paramedics to arrive before he died.       
     This site will be our journal to share our  road to recovery and rehab.   We are using it to keep family and friends updated in one place. We appreciate your support and words of hope and encouragement. Thank you for visiting.
